I would suggest writing out some theoretical army lists for any list you would like to play.
As an example, I did this with Salamanders and Scions because both feature mounted infantry and armor, especially LR variants. I found that with the same set of models I could field 4500-5000 points in each army, depending on how they were organized. Now I have a defined set of models to acquire.
I've done the same thing with other combinations of armies. In addition to the Sallie/Scions combo, I organized these:
Codex/Blood Angel/Raven Guard (my home-brew RG list) - My Codex army is infantry-heavy and armor-light. That means it fits with both the BA and RG lists.
White Scars/Dark Angels - White Scars bikes double nicely as Ravenwing. Speeders work as good support for White Scars (Typhoons do a nice "counts as" for White Scars Tempests), and also as additional Ravenwing elements for DAs. First Company Terminators with Transport for the White Scars double as Deathwing and Ironwing (for the old-skool people) for the DAs.
